TMS320VC5402 DSP处理器最小系统设计解析
4星 · 超过85%的资源 需积分: 10 25 浏览量
更新于2024-07-25
收藏 375KB PDF 举报
"TMS320系列DSP处理器tms320vc5402的最小系统原理图"
本文档详细介绍了TMS320VC5402 DSP处理器的最小系统原理图,该处理器是德州仪器(Texas Instruments)生产的一款高性能数字信号处理器。这个最小系统包括了芯片外围所需的各个关键组成部分,旨在为用户提供一个基础平台,以便进行开发和应用设计。
1. **连接器 (Connectors)**
- 连接器在系统中起到接口作用,例如并行端口、JTAG端口,用于调试和数据传输。JTAG端口用于通过边界扫描测试访问设备内部的引脚,便于编程和故障排查。
2. **时钟 (Clocks)**
- DSP处理器通常需要精确的时钟信号来控制其运算速度。文档中可能涉及时钟发生器、晶体振荡器等部件,确保TMS320VC5402正常工作所需的时钟频率。
3. **存储器 (Memory)**
- TMS320VC5402通常需要外部存储器扩展,如SRAM或Flash,以存储程序和数据。这部分可能包括内存解码电路,确保正确访问不同的存储区域。
4. **总线多路复用器 (BSPMUX)**
- 用于选择和切换不同外设到总线的接口,提高系统灵活性。
5. **CPLD (复杂可编程逻辑器件)**
- CPLD用于实现复杂的逻辑功能,如地址解码、控制信号生成等,简化系统设计并提供额外的灵活性。
6. **DSP处理器 (DSP)**
- TMS320VC5402是系统的核心,它处理数字信号并执行程序指令。
7. **缓冲器 (Buffers)**
- 缓冲器用来增强信号驱动能力,确保信号在整个系统中的稳定传输。
8. **UART & RS232**
- 串行通信接口,用于与其他设备进行通信,如PC或其他微控制器。
9. **DAA (数据接入适配器)**
- 用于电话线路通信的电路,支持模拟语音信号的数字化处理。
10. **音频编解码器 (Audio Codecs)**
- 处理音频输入和输出,包括麦克风和扬声器的接口。
11. **电压转换 (Voltage Translation)**
- 在不同电源电压之间转换,确保所有组件都能在正确的电压下工作。
12. **扩展缓冲器 (Expansion Buffers)**
- 支持系统扩展,如增加额外的I/O或功能模块。
13. **复位电路 (Reset Circuitry)**
- 确保系统在启动或异常情况后能正确初始化。
14. **LEDs & DIP开关 (LEDs/DIP Switches)**
- 提供状态指示和手动配置选项。
15. **输入电源和接地 (Input Power & Ground)**
- 为整个系统供电和提供参考地。
16. **DECOUPLING CAPS (去耦电容)**
- 用于滤除电源噪声,确保处理器得到纯净的电源。
这些组件共同构成了TMS320VC5402 DSP处理器的最小系统,为开发者提供了构建各种应用的基础。每个部分都有其特定的电路设计和组件选择,以满足处理器的需求和系统的整体性能。这份文档的目的是帮助读者理解这些组件如何协同工作,以及如何根据具体应用进行定制。通过这份PDF文档,开发者可以更好地理解和构建基于TMS320VC5402的系统。
2023-06-24 上传
点击了解资源详情
2010-09-17 上传
2023-11-06 上传
2021-03-30 上传
2009-03-04 上传
夏日的风帆
- 粉丝: 4
- 资源: 15
最新资源
- Java集合ArrayList实现字符串管理及效果展示
- 实现2D3D相机拾取射线的关键技术
- LiveLy-公寓管理门户:创新体验与技术实现
- 易语言打造的快捷禁止程序运行小工具
- Microgateway核心:实现配置和插件的主端口转发
- 掌握Java基本操作:增删查改入门代码详解
- Apache Tomcat 7.0.109 Windows版下载指南
- Qt实现文件系统浏览器界面设计与功能开发
- ReactJS新手实验:搭建与运行教程
- 探索生成艺术:几个月创意Processing实验
- Django框架下Cisco IOx平台实战开发案例源码解析
- 在Linux环境下配置Java版VTK开发环境
- 29街网上城市公司网站系统v1.0:企业建站全面解决方案
- WordPress CMB2插件的Suggest字段类型使用教程
- TCP协议实现的Java桌面聊天客户端应用
- ANR-WatchDog: 检测Android应用无响应并报告异常